Study of M2ES With Paclitaxel/Carboplatin (TC Regimen) in Advanced Non Small Cell Lung Cancer (NSCLC)

The purpose of this study is to evaluate safety and tolerance of M2ES with TC regimen in advanced NSCLC.

Inclusion criteria

  • Aged 18-70 years old;
  • Patients with Ⅲ/Ⅳ NSCLC confirmed by histopathology or cytology who ware naive or previous chemotherapy without TC regimen;
  • No contraindication for chemotherapy;
  • ECOG performance scale 0-2;
  • No history of anti-angiogenesis therapy;
  • Patients are voluntary to participate and sigh the informed contents.

Exclusion criteria

  • Concurrent use of other anti-cancer agents;
  • Allergic history to M2ES and biological agents;
  • Pregnant or breast-feeding women;
  • With other malignancy;
  • With severe cardiopulmonary disease;
  • Uncontrolled brain metastasis patients;
  • Other conditions that are regarded for exclusion by the trialists.

Treatment and study plan

M2ES

Drug

polyethylene glycol rh recombinant endostatin

Primary outcomes

  1. Adverse events incidence,including severe adverse events incidence

    Time frame: one year

Secondary outcomes

  1. Tumor response rate and disease controlled rate

    Time frame: one year
